The Eaton molded case circuit breaker from the Moeller series NZM is designed to meet the demands of both feeder and branch circuits. Combining robust performance with a compact design, it ensures reliable protection for electrical systems. The device is tailored for use in North America, aligning with necessary compliance standards. Its three-pole configuration, along with an amperage rating of 125A and voltage rating of 440V, makes it suitable for various applications. Engineered with advanced thermal-magnetic technology, this circuit breaker is not just efficient

it also boasts an IP20 degree of protection, ensuring safety in operation. Whether you’re a panel builder or an installer, this product offers the reliability you need for demanding environments.
